Why Window Maintenance is Important

Windows are subjected to numerous aspects such as wind, rain, and temperature fluctuations, which can deteriorate their condition with time. Routine maintenance is crucial for several factors:

  1. Energy Efficiency: Well-maintained windows lower heating & cooling costs by minimizing drafts and enhancing insulation.
  2. Avoiding Damage: Routine evaluations can assist determine and address concerns before they escalate into pricey repairs.
  3. Aesthetic Value: Clean and well-maintained windows enhance the general look of your home, enhancing curb appeal.
  4. Safety: Regular checks can assist guarantee that windows open and close properly, avoiding security dangers.

Typical Window Problems

Understanding possible issues can assist homeowners deal with issues before they become serious. Here's a table highlighting typical window problems and their causes:

ProblemDescriptionPossible Causes
DraftsAir leaks around window framesDamaged weather condition stripping, spaces
Foggy WindowsCondensation in between double panesSeal failure
Cracked FramesVisible fractures in frame productWeather condition damage, impact
Stuck WindowsWindows that won't open or close efficientlyPaint accumulation, misalignment
Leaky WindowsWater entering through the framePoor installation, seal failure
Broken LocksWindows that can't be locked safelyUse and tear, corrosion

Window Maintenance Checklist

A well-structured maintenance checklist offers an organized approach to keep windows in peak condition. Here's a detailed window maintenance checklist:

Monthly

  • Examine Weather Stripping

    • Try to find used or missing areas.
    • Change as essential to ensure a tight seal.
  • Clean Window Frames

    • Clean down with a damp fabric to get rid of dirt and particles.

Quarterly

  • Tidy Glass Surfaces

    • Utilize a glass cleaner for a streak-free surface.
    • Attend to any difficult water spots or mineral deposits.
  • Look for Drafts

    • Light a candle near the window edges; if the flame flickers, that's a draft.

Biannually

  • Inspect and Lubricate Hardware

    • Examine locks, hinges, and tracks; use lubricant if required.
  • Analyze Caulking

    • Look for cracks or spaces that require resealing.

Yearly

  • Professional Inspection

    • Consider working with a professional to evaluate the condition of your windows.
  • Clear Out Drainage Holes

    • Ensure that drain holes are clear to prevent water accumulation.

Every 5-10 Years

  • Change Weather Stripping

    • If it appears worn or ineffective, change it to preserve insulation.
  • Reseal Windows

    • Use brand-new caulking to guarantee proper sealing and insulation.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How often should I clean my windows?

House owners must ideally clean their windows every 1-3 months, depending upon the local climate and ecological conditions.

2. What should I utilize to clean my windows?

A service of warm water and moderate meal soap is typically reliable. For streak-free shine, consider commercial glass cleaners or vinegar blended with water.

3. How can I inform if my windows need to be changed?

Signs that it might be time for a replacement consist of comprehensive fogging, split frames, and persistent drafts. If repairs are frequent and pricey, replacement may be more economical.

4. Can I carry out window maintenance myself?

Yes, lots of window maintenance tasks can be performed by house owners. However, for complicated concerns or potential safety risks, it's advisable to speak with a professional.

5. What is the very best method to avoid window leakages?

Correct installation, regular evaluations, and changing worn weather condition removing and caulking can successfully avoid leakages.

6. How can I enhance my window's energy performance?

In addition to routine maintenance, consider setting up energy-efficient windows or including insulating window treatments, such as thermal drapes or tones.
